What Matters Most

Your driving record and credit score are the two biggest factors after location. A single at-fault accident can raise premiums 40-60%.

Pro Tip

Bundle home and auto with the same insurer for 10-25% savings. Also ask about low-mileage discounts if you work from home.

Common Mistake

Keeping the same policy year after year without shopping around. Rates vary wildly between carriers — switching saves the average driver $400-700 per year.

Best Time to Buy

Rates tend to be lowest in December and January when fewer people are shopping. Request quotes during the holiday season for best pricing.

Why Rates Vary in NY

Insurance is regulated at the state level. NY's framework generally tracks the competitive market. Within Syracuse, your ZIP code is often the single biggest factor — rates vary 30-50% across neighborhoods.

How to Lower Your Premiums

In Syracuse: (1) Bundle policies — saves 10-25%. (2) Shop aggressively — rates vary 40-60% between carriers in NY. (3) Raise deductibles strategically. (4) Ask about every possible discount — many carriers offer 20+ that agents don't proactively mention.

Hidden Costs of Car Insurance in Syracuse That Most People Miss

The sticker price of car insurance in Syracuse doesn't tell the full story. Your actual annual cost includes the premium, yes — but also deductibles, copays, coverage gaps, and rate increases after claims. In NY, the average policyholder files a claim every 3-5 years, and post-claim premium increases typically run 20-40% for the following 3 years. That one claim can cost more in premium hikes than the payout you received.
